158 Chapter 13-Working with color server tools on your computer Creating a job ticket in Mac OS 1. On your desktop, double-click the JTcreator.app icon. The Creo Color Server JT window opens. 2. To add a server, perform the following actions: a. From the Tools menu, select Use JT Settings From > Setup. b. In the Setup window, click Add. c. In the Server Name box, type the name of the server that you want to add. d. In the IP/Host Name box, type the IP address or the host name of the server. e. Click Add. The job ticket settings for the server are loaded. f. In the Setup window, click OK. 3. From the Tools menu, select Use JT Settings From and in the list that appears, click the server that you just added. The following message appears if unsaved changes were made to the current open job ticket: Are you sure you want to change the displayed server without changing the template? 4. Click Yes. 5. Set the required job parameters. 6. Click Save. 7. In the Save JDF dialog box, type a name for the job ticket, and click Save. The job ticket is saved in the path defined in the Preferences window. Loading job parameters from a selected server Requirements: The server from which you want to load job parameters must be in the Creo Color Server Job Ticket list of servers. 1. From the Tools menu, select Use JT Settings From. 2. In the list that appears, click the server from which you want to load job parameters. A check mark appears next to the selected server, and the Creo Color Server Job Ticket software loads the appropriate job parameters window.
